The iPhone 16E is the non secular successor to the iPhone SE, although Apple would quite you not consider it that means. The SE was the corporate’s budget-friendly line, a sort of close-out discount bin provide on final technology’s chassis with upgraded internals. The design was wildly outdated by the tip, however, hey, it solely value $429. That line seems to have ended with the 16E, which is absolutely a member of the iPhone 16 sequence.

As an alternative of an older design that’s a very whole lot, we now have a contemporary design that’s solely sort of a deal

However as an alternative of an older design that’s a very whole lot, we now have a contemporary design that’s solely sort of a deal. It’s $200 cheaper than the $799 iPhone 16 and has an identical 6.1-inch OLED display screen. There’s no Dynamic Island — only a notch. And as an alternative of two rear lenses, you get only one: a 48-megapixel important digicam and no ultrawide to go along with it. You get wired charging, however no MagSafe. The Motion Button, however no Digicam Management. This, not that. And so forth.

The 16E’s display screen may be very probably a model of the iPhone 14’s display screen, full with a notch housing the Face ID and front-facing digicam array. The common 16’s display screen will get just a bit brighter in idea, however in follow they give the impression of being about the identical to me, brightness-wise. The 16E’s display screen doesn’t go down to 1 nit just like the 16’s can, which is simply too unhealthy as a result of it’s truthfully cool as hell and helpful while you’re attempting to not get up your partner with a brilliant cellphone display screen. The notch’s existence additionally means no Dynamic Island — that’s the pill-shaped cutout Apple launched with the iPhone 14 Professional, which homes tiny bits of well timed information you may wish to see at a look.

All that time-sensitive info, like reside sports activities scores and the proximity of your incoming Uber, remains to be offered on the 16E’s lock display screen. However the Dynamic Island retains it on the prime of your display screen whilst you do different issues in your cellphone. It’s helpful, and having gotten used to it, I missed it on the 16E. The additional visible affirmation is good when you could have a timer or display screen recording in progress. The Dynamic Island in all probability gained’t be an important loss should you’re used to a cellphone with out it, although.

MagSafe is likely to be one other case of “should you’ve by no means had it then you definitely gained’t miss it,” however I’m rather less inclined to shrug off its absence on the 16E. Positive, there’s nonetheless Qi wi-fi charging. And you’ll at all times use a case with magnets as a workaround if you wish to use MagSafe equipment, even when it’s not a chic answer. However the great thing about MagSafe is the simplicity, and should you’re a case-hater like me then it’s a helpful means so as to add a Pop Socket or a low-profile pockets to your cellphone with out committing to a case. Apart from the SE, each iPhone from the 12-series onward has MagSafe. It appears like a regular characteristic now, and it’s laborious to know why Apple left it out.

The iPhone 16E’s rear digicam makes use of a 48-megapixel sensor that mixes pixels to assist it higher collect mild, and it delivers good photographs in most conditions. There’s no ultrawide digicam and subsequently no macro images both. I missed the ultrawide greater than as soon as when stepping backward to border a large shot wasn’t doable. There’s a good portrait mode, although it’s the older model the place you possibly can’t change the main target level after the very fact. Photographic Types can be found to assist dial in shade replica, although they’re additionally the previous-gen model and you’ll’t tweak undertones.

It is a digicam system most individuals will likely be completely pleased with. In case you’re in the slightest degree inclined photographically and need extra flexibility — each in focal vary and processing choices — then take into account an iPhone 16 or 16 Professional. However it’s a very good digicam for a basic viewers. There’s glorious 4K video recording, optical picture stabilization, and dependable shade replica. A extra superior cellphone digicam would provide higher possibilities of capturing transferring topics in dim mild, however this one retains up in most conditions.

A lot of the 16E is acquainted, however there’s one solely new part: Apple’s C1 modem. That is its debut look, and the highway to Apple’s first in-house modem was reportedly stuffed with setbacks and delays. I’ve used it for the previous week to make FaceTime calls, add massive video recordsdata in crowded locations, and stream YouTube on the bus. I examined it alongside a daily iPhone 16 geared up with a Qualcomm-made modem — each on Verizon — and I didn’t see any constant distinction in efficiency between the 2.

Each time I believed the iPhone 16 was faring higher with video name high quality or add speeds, I’d attempt the identical check once more and the 16E would come out forward. If I have been none the wiser, I wouldn’t have given the modem a second thought as I used the cellphone. Given the issue Apple seemingly encountered constructing this factor and the complexity of a mobile modem, “it appears superb” is definitely an important final result for the C1.

Apple claims switching to its personal modem has allowed it to squeeze a little bit extra battery life out of the 16E, providing “the very best battery life ever on a 6.1-inch iPhone,” according to its press release. Battery life definitely appears good. I spent a day out of the home utilizing lots of navigation, streaming a podcast, testing connectivity, and watching YouTube. I clocked about 5 hours of display screen time and was solely right down to 41 % by the tip of the day. I’m assured that most individuals may get by means of a day comfortably on this battery, however that’s not my largest concern. I’m extra interested in long-term battery well being — Apple’s latest observe report right here is spotty — and there’s simply no means of figuring out that after per week of testing.

Conform to proceed: Apple iPhone 16E, 16, 16 Plus, 16 Professional, and 16 Professional Max

Each good gadget now requires you to comply with a sequence of phrases and situations earlier than you should utilize it — contracts that nobody truly reads. It’s unattainable for us to learn and analyze each single certainly one of these agreements. However we’re going to start out counting precisely what number of occasions you need to hit “agree” to make use of gadgets after we evaluation them since these are agreements most individuals don’t learn and undoubtedly can’t negotiate.

To make use of any of the iPhone 16 fashions, you need to comply with:

  • The iOS phrases and situations, which you’ll be able to have despatched to you by e mail
  • Apple’s guarantee settlement, which you’ll be able to have despatched to you by e mail

These agreements are nonnegotiable, and you’ll’t use the cellphone in any respect should you don’t comply with them.

The iPhone additionally prompts you to arrange Apple Money and Apple Pay at setup, which additional means you need to comply with:

  • The Apple Money settlement, which specifies that companies are literally offered by Inexperienced Dot Financial institution and Apple Funds Inc. and additional consists of the next agreements:
  • The Apple Money phrases and situations
  • The digital communications settlement
  • The Inexperienced Dot Financial institution privateness coverage
  • Direct funds phrases and situations
  • Direct funds privateness discover
  • Apple Funds Inc. license

In case you add a bank card to Apple Pay, you need to comply with:

  • The phrases out of your bank card supplier, which don’t have an choice to be emailed

Ultimate tally: two obligatory agreements, seven non-compulsory agreements for Apple Money, and one non-compulsory settlement for Apple Pay.
